Ovi, Malkin, Kuznetsov dress as mascots to surprise kids at KHL game
YouTube
Call him "Fantastic Mr. Ovechkin."
A group of Russian kids thought they were playing a fun game against some mascots during an intermission of a KHL game between SKA St. Peterburg and Lada Togliatti on Friday, but it turns out they were actually on the ice with Alex Ovechkin, Evgeni Malkin and Evgeny Kuznetsov.
Judging by the still shot, Ovechkin appears to be dressed as a fox, Kuznetsov is wearing a raccoon tail, and Malkin is sporting cat-claw gloves.

The trio are in Russia training for the upcoming World Cup of Hockey.
